Microsoft Word Bas db access L. doc


Butunlikka chegaralanushlar


Download 2.55 Mb.
Pdf ko'rish
bet20/96
Sana24.09.2023
Hajmi2.55 Mb.
#1686902
1   ...   16   17   18   19   20   21   22   23   ...   96
Bog'liq
Access 1

2.3.3 Butunlikka chegaralanushlar 
Butunlik (inglizcha – teginmaslik, saqlanish, bir butun) – deganda har qanday vaqtda 
ma’lumotlarning to’griligi tushuniladi. Bu maqsad ma’lum chegarada bo’lisi kerak. MBBT 
ma’lumotlar bazasiga kiritilayotgan har bir bo’ak qiymatning to’g’riligini tekshirish imkonini 
bermaydi. Masalan, kiritilayotgan 5 (hafta kun nomerini ko’rsatuvchi) qiymati haqiqatda 3 ga teng 
bo’ishini tekshirmaydi. Boshqa tomondan 9 qiymati aniq xato bo’ladi va MBBT bunga javob 
qaytaradi. Chunki bu nomer (1,2,3,4,5,6,7) sonlar to’plami ichida yo’q. 
MBning butunligini ta’minlashni ma’lumotlarni har xil to’g’ri bolmagan o’zgarishlar yoki 
buzulishdan himoyalash deb qarash kerak. Zamonaviy MBBT butunlikni ta’minlash uchun bir qancha 
vositalarga ega: 
Butunlikni aniqlash usulini uchta guruhga ajratadi:
Mohiyat bo’yicha butunlik
Murojaat bo’yicha butunlik; 
Foydalanuvchi 
aniqlaydigan 
butunlik. 
Butunlikni aniqlash usullari: 
1.Birinchi kalitda qatnashuvchi atributlarga aniqlanmagan qiymatlar qabul qulinishiga ruxsat 
etilmaydi.
2.Tashqi kalit qiymati quyidagilar biri bolishi kerak: 
Birinchi kalit qiymatiga teng
• To’liq aniqlanmagan, ya’ni tshqi kalitda qatnshadigan har bir atribut qiymati
aniqlanmagan bo’lishi kerak. 
3.Har qanday konkret ma’lumotlar bazasi uchun qoshimcha qoidalar spetsifikatsiyalari mavjud. 
Ular ishlab chiquvchilar yordamida aniqlanadi. Ko’p hollarda tekshiriladi: 
• U yoki bu atributning unikalligi; 
Qiymat diapazoni
• Qiymatlar to’plami aloqadorligi. 


TATU NF
Access 2003 Laboratoria ishi
Bobojonov Elmurod 
19-bet 
2.4 Ma’lumotlarning relyatsion strukturasi 
Ma’lumotlarni qayta ishlash uchun to’plamlar nazariyasi ishlatiladi (birlashma, kesishma
farqlash, dekart ko’paytma). Har qanday ma’lumotlarni tasvirlash ikki o’lchovli maxsys turli 
matematikadan ma’lum aloqa (relyatsion)gi jadvallar to’plamiga keladi.
Relyatsion model ma’lumotlarining eng kichik birligi – bu model ma’lumotlar qiymati uchun 
alohida atamardir
Bir xil turdagi atomar qiymatlar to’plamiga domen deyiladi. Masalan, Reys nomeri domeni- butun 
musbat sonlar to’plami.
Domen ma’nosi quiyidagilardan iborat. Agar ikki atribut qiymatlari bir domendan olingan 
bo’lsa, unda bu ikkita ishlatiladigan atributlarni taqqoslash ma’nosi bor. Agar ikkita atribut qiymatlari 
har xil domenlardan olingan bo’lsa, ular taqqoslash ma’no bermaydi. Masalan, reys nomeri bilan 
chipta narxini solishtirish mumkinmi.

Download 2.55 Mb.

Do'stlaringiz bilan baham:
1   ...   16   17   18   19   20   21   22   23   ...   96




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ling